Output 3ba456f8de02579dc41937db415252204a8d59ad3fc87c53d111a63a624c65e3:10

value
1380127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37407107893c1cedd1da0fc2502f45287fc67 OP_EQUAL
address
3BMEX7WkidV4D2dxVAjfct9ubege6G7zzp
transaction
3ba456f8de02579dc41937db415252204a8d59ad3fc87c53d111a63a624c65e3
spent
true